I have a bizarre segmentation fault which I am trying to understand, and
I hope someone can help me. I've reduced the problem to the following
macro:
{
gROOT->Reset();
Int_t i=1;
Int_t n = 3;
Int_t mask[n]={0,0,1};
for (i=0;i<n;i++) {
if (mask[i]) {
TString hello = "hello";
cout << hello << endl;
}
}
}
This results in a segmentation fault. However, if mask is, say, {1,0,1},
then there is no segmentation fault, and the macro behaves as expected.
In fact, the only configuration of mask elements for which a segmentation
fault occurs is zero in the first element and at least one non-zero
element.
I'm running root 3.02/07 on Linux, if it makes a difference.
